Product Description:
The 195N3100 harmonic filter is part of the AHF Advanced Harmonic Filters group from Danfoss and starts off with a tight, compact feel thanks to its 200 x 75 x 168 mm size. Maximum load for current runs at 4.0 A and the biggest voltage allowed comes in at 480 V AC. Here, filtering works at the right frequency point since the maximum output frequency reaches 120 Hz, covering a decent range for typical drive or motor setups. The enclosure holding the whole filter rests at IP20, so it stays mostly protected in regular dry environments but stays vented for cooling.
Mounting goes in only one direction, with the vertical only option built in, and that setup keeps the airflow running with no struggle. For connection flexibility, a max cable length of 25 m @ 380–480 V can be reached when screened wiring is used, making the unit ready for lineups that stretch a bit further across the shop floor. The weight stays right at 2.4 kg, so the filter doesn't overload its mounting panel or throw off a drive cabinet’s balance. Inside sits a PTC integral thermistor for thermal response, which helps with immediate temperature monitoring and extra circuit protection just in case things get too hot.
Clearances are part of the deal on this filter, asking for 100 mm above and below the chassis for steady cooling. Each unit can be fit side-by-side without any trouble since there’s no minimum space needed, which is useful when packing several in a tight row. Max voltage from line-to-earth is 300 V AC and screening control helps shield the system from outside noise. Sticking to its main job, the 195N3100 works for knocking out risky harmonics, which often show up in automated cells with variable speed drives or smaller industrial machines.
